Appeals dispute decision to toss law regulating use of pesticides, GMOs

STAR-ADVERTISER / NOVEMBER 2013
A judge’s decision to overturn Ordinance 960, which covers pesticides and genetically modified crops, has been appealed by four groups and Kauai?County. GMO opponents cheered last year as they listened to testimony on Bill 2491, which became the ordinance, podcast from inside the Kauai County Council Building.
